What Does the Adrenocortex Stress Profile Measure?

The Adrenocortex Stress Profile Test includes:

  • Cortisol : Measured at four time points during the day to map the body’s natural stress rhythm
  • DHEA (Dehydroepiandrosterone) : A balancing hormone that counteracts cortisol and supports immune and metabolic health

How the Adrenocortex Stress Profile Test Works

This standardized protocol is widely used in functional medicine tests and integrated medicine testing:

  1. Saliva Collection : Simple, at-home collection at four key times: morning, noon, evening, and night
  2. Laboratory Analysis : Advanced analytical methods used to quantify cortisol and DHEA
  3. Results & Interpretation : A detailed report showing hormone patterns, ratios, and deviations from the normal diurnal rhythm
